We are currently looking to engage multiple Embedded Linux Consultants to support on a new project for a longstanding client of ours. They are looking for hands-on experience with Embedded Linux & Low Level Device Drivers to come in and support on an OUTSIDE IR35 Basis.

Successful candidates must have demonstrable experience in taking a product through the full lifecycle.

  • Logistics: Onsite - North Cambridge
  • Contract - OUTSIDE IR35
  • Start - 22nd June
  • Rate - DOE
  • Duration - 6 Months

This is a longstanding client & the project is expected to run longer than the initial duration.
